    WINforCS has its virtual fall meeting on Dec 5, 2023, from 4- 6 PM.   2 clock hours are available for this event.   This session will contain breakout sessions discussing responsible AI use in classrooms, instructional strategies, and collaborative learning. 

    To sign up, go to https://www.winforcs.org/event/winforcs-professional-network-23-24/

    WINforCS is run by the CS leadership in each of the ESDs and OSPI.

    The University of Washington's Paul G. Allen School of Computer Science and Engineering (Allen School) invites high schools to celebrate with us! 

             Virtual Events: December 4th-8th

      • Learn about computing, meet current Allen School students, and engage in computing activities via Zoom!<o:p></o:p>
    • Open House: Saturday, December 9th, 1-4:30pm
      • Join us on the UW - Seattle campus in the Bill & Melinda Gates Building to celebrate Computer Science Education Week in person!

    Interested high school students can visit our Allen School Computer Science Education Week page to view a full list of our events, learn more, and register. Please share the flyer with students in your community who would be interested!
